Godrej Properties Limited (GPL), one of India’s leading real estate developers, has announced the acquisition of a prime 26-acre land parcel near Sarjapur Road, South Bengaluru. The company plans to develop a premium residential project on the site, with an estimated revenue potential of ₹1,100 crore.

This acquisition marks another strategic expansion for GPL in Bengaluru’s thriving residential corridors, further consolidating its footprint in one of the city’s fastest-growing micro-markets.


Sarjapur Road: A High-Growth Corridor

Sarjapur Road has rapidly emerged as one of Bengaluru’s most vibrant real estate destinations. Its connectivity to major employment hubs—including Whitefield, Outer Ring Road, and Electronic City—makes it a preferred location for working professionals.

The area also offers excellent social infrastructure, with proximity to reputed schools, hospitals, retail centres, and leisure avenues, contributing to sustained homebuyer demand and robust absorption levels.


Strengthening a Proven Track Record

Godrej Properties already has a strong presence in South Bengaluru, with successful projects like Godrej Park Retreat and Godrej Lakeside Orchards. Both developments have recorded high customer uptake and steady sales momentum, reinforcing the Sarjapur corridor’s status as a high-demand residential micro-market.
